I just replaced the steering cable in my 91 Nautique.  It seems the 91 and 92 years are the rotary type of systems.  My question is what should my expectation be for how it steers?  On the trailer it spins pretty freely both left and right as expected, but while running left is what I would consider Okay and right (against the prop?) it is "firm" to turn the wheel.  My friends 94 can be driven with 1 finger turning both directions.  

Any info on the 91-92 steering vs the others and is what mine is like the expected feel when driving?  I am olkay with it if that is how it is, but if there is something else I should do let me know.

I'd look under your boat and your friend's boat, compare props (brand and pitch, diameter, rake of the blades and distance of the blade tips from the rudder) to see if there's a difference.

Or swap props with him and see if his steering gets harder to the right Wink
